Search your system files for a text file named HOSTS (It does not have an extension). Remove any line referencing www.counterterrorismblog.org . Also try the following command in a DOS window: IPCONFIG /FLUSHDNS
When I click on the blog link I get http://counterterrorismblog.org with a latest change date of August 16, 2009. Try the URL without the www and see if that makes a difference.
You might also try just using their address in your url. copy/paste 63.247.142.114
